Purpose

This report follows the Member Promoted Issue
(MPI) raised by Councillor Sullivan at Kincardine & Mearns Area
Committee, in support of the Newtonhill Community, relating to the
installation of additional Christmas Lights in Newtonhill.
Following Kincardine & Mearns Area Committee on 29 October
2024, the Committee instructed Roads & Infrastructure Services
to submit a report to Infrastructure Services Committee to seek
approval of the installation contrary to the current Council
Policy.

Content

Members voted 11:3 in favour of the motion of
“Agree that the current policy should be followed and the
Christmas Lights installation be denied; and to expedite the review
of the Festive Lighting Policy with a report to be brought back to
Infrastructure Services Committee in October 2025” therefore
the motion was carried.
